Top 5 Gacha Games on Android in Poland Q1 2022
Explore the performance of the top 5 Gacha games on the Android platform in Poland during Q1 2022, including tr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
In the first quarter of 2022, the top 5 Gacha games on the Android platform in Poland demonstrated diverse trends in downloads, revenue, and active user metrics. Below is a detailed performance analysis of these games.
Rise of Kingdoms: Lost Crusade from LilithGames saw a significant upward trend in weekly revenue, starting at around $23K and peaking at nearly $50K by the end of March. Weekly downloads fluctuated, reaching a high of approximately 40K in early January before declining to around 12K by the end of the quarter. Meanwhile, weekly active users increased steadily from 80K to a peak of 323K in late February, before declining to 176K at the end of March.
8 Ball Pool by Miniclip.com maintained consistent weekly revenue, starting at $12K and ending at around $9K. The game's weekly downloads started at 13K, peaking at 15K in mid-January, and then settling around 9K towards the end of the quarter. Active users showed a stable trend, starting at 128K and peaking at 153K in mid-January, before stabilizing around 141K by the end of March.
Head Ball 2 - Online Soccer from Masomo Gaming experienced a decline in weekly revenue, starting at $3K and ending at approximately $1.2K. Weekly downloads saw an overall increase, starting at 10K and reaching a peak of 14.5K by the end of March. The game's weekly active users remained relatively stable, starting at 48K and ending at around 57K.
Warpath: Ace Shooter, also by LilithGames, showed steady weekly revenue, starting at $12K and peaking at $21K by the end of the quarter. Weekly downloads demonstrated significant growth, from 1.8K at the start to over 17K in mid-March. Active users increased from 15K to over 55K by the end of March, displaying a strong upward trend throughout the quarter.
Top War: Battle Game by RiverGame exhibited a stable weekly revenue trend, starting at $18K and peaking at approximately $23K in mid-March. Weekly downloads saw a decline, starting at 5K and dropping to around 3.5K by the end of the quarter. The game's active users grew from 32K to a peak of 53K in mid-January, before stabilizing around 30K by the end of March.
